When is a sworn contract translation required?
- Foreign employment contract for a work permit or professional visa
- Lease agreement presented to a bank or authority to prove your foreign domicile
- Property sale contract as part of an international succession or notarial file
- Marriage contract drawn up abroad, presented to a Belgian notary or court
- Foreign company articles for a commercial or banking procedure in Belgium
